Rector

2.6K posts

Rector banner
Rector

Rector

@rectorphp

Instant Upgrades and Instant Refactorings for PHP Applications. Why do it manually? #rectorphp Created by @votrubaT

PHP Community Katılım Aralık 2018
2 Takip Edilen4.4K Takipçiler
Rector retweetledi
Tomas Votruba
Tomas Votruba@VotrubaT·
Just had a wrap up call with one of our clients. They surprised us with very nice stats😇 * 2230 merged PRs in 20 months * thats 111.5 merged PRs a month * type coverage from 35 % to 96 % * 10 forked repositories to 0 Not bad for a part-time job 🥳🥳🥳
English
0
1
6
1K
Rector retweetledi
アーメド。
アーメド。@skiupace·
من الأدوات الي ما استغني عنها بكل مشروع أشتغله هي "php rector"، أداة مفتوحة المصدر يوم تشغلها على codebase مشروعك تسوي refactoring وتحسينات للكود، ويمدي تضبط الـrules من خلال ملف الـconfig، ولـLaravel بتحتاج تثبت ذا الـplugin معها: getrector.com github.com/driftingly/rec…
アーメド。 tweet media
العربية
0
2
17
1.4K
Rector retweetledi
Rector retweetledi
Tomas Votruba
Tomas Votruba@VotrubaT·
New @rectorphp 2.4.1 is out! It includes important performance fix, two new ternary rules, --rules-summary option to get quick overview of most common applied rules, and more ↓ github.com/rectorphp/rect…
Tomas Votruba tweet media
English
2
8
27
1.8K
Rector retweetledi
Laravel Live UK
Laravel Live UK@LaravelLiveUK·
🎤 Speaker Announcement! @PovilasKorop will be talking about "Laravel Starter Kits: Past, Present and Future". 🎟️ Get your tickets: laravellive.uk
Laravel Live UK tweet media
English
3
7
25
2.9K
Rector retweetledi
Kay
Kay@kayintveen·
@VotrubaT @rectorphp vendor/bin/jack open is such a clean name. been doing dependency bumps manually like a caveman. rector is already in the toolchain so this is a no-brainer add
English
0
2
2
423
Rector retweetledi
Tomas Votruba
Tomas Votruba@VotrubaT·
Great time to do annual spring dependency bump 🙏 To bump "all you can with one command", give @rectorphp Jack tool a go: #2-open-up-next-versions" target="_blank" rel="nofollow noopener">github.com/rectorphp/jack… vendor/bin/jack open
Povilas Korop | Laravel Courses Creator & Youtuber@PovilasKorop

Laravel major version is a chance to bump the underlying packages. So in Laravel 13, I noticed these: - PHP min 8.2 to 8.3 - PHPUnit: added v12/13, dropped v10 - Symfony components: ^7.4.0 || ^8.0.0 - Laravel Tinker: v3 vs v2 - Dropped laravel/sail in laravel/laravel skeleton

English
2
2
17
2.9K
Rector retweetledi
Peter Fox
Peter Fox@peterfox·
Want the ability to write Rector rules without all the learning involved. 🦾 Rector Developer skill is my latest bit of fun. I've already used it for Rector Laravel and it's pretty good 😄 This will generate a new rule for you but also knows how to write useful tests.
Peter Fox tweet media
English
4
7
31
1.8K
Rector retweetledi
Peter Fox
Peter Fox@peterfox·
Built an agent skill for writing @rectorphp rules. This seems pretty good so far. Writes the rule and tests correctly. Looking forward to trying to do more things like this.
English
2
1
8
632
Rector
Rector@rectorphp·
Now this is cool! Tempest 3 comes with @rectorphp upgrade set out of the box! Nice touch for the devs, who have now zero work with the new version. #breaking-changes-and-automatic-upgrades" target="_blank" rel="nofollow noopener">tempestphp.com/blog/tempest-3…
Rector tweet media
English
0
5
30
2.3K
Rector retweetledi
Tomas Votruba
Tomas Votruba@VotrubaT·
Last week, we've released brand new set for PHPUnit 12.5 upgrade (requires PHP 8.3+) Here is the best of it: getrector.com/blog/upgrade-t… From projects in the wild, it helped reduce 4000 notices to dozens 🚀
Tomas Votruba tweet media
English
0
3
11
1.1K